Project Overview

Glyn Taff Solar Farm to the east of Pontypridd, will provide 39.9 Megawatt peak (MWp) of clean, zero-carbon, renewable energy, equivalent to providing enough power to meet the annual electricity needs of approximately 12,000 homes.

The operational life of the development would be 35 years, providing approximately 18,000 tonnes of carbon emissions savings and significant improvement to biodiversity in the locality.

A’Chruach

  • United Kingdom
  • Wind
  • Operational
  • Capacity

    43 MW

  • Production

    106,321 MWh/year

  • CO2 saved

    18,545 Tonnes/year

Chruach Wind Farm is located in Kilmichael Forest which is around 4km west of Minard in Argyll. The site ‘s 21 turbines are spectacularly set in the rugged Highland terrain, towering over the managed pine forest and looking north towards Loch Glashan. Construction work began in November 2014 and was completed in March 2016. As well as building the turbines, the project required the completion of over 13.5km of access tracks, built with locally sourced rock. The concrete for the turbine bases was also produced on site to limit environmental impact. The wind farm began full production in March 2016.

Ardrossan

  • United Kingdom
  • Wind
  • Operational
  • Capacity

    30 MW

  • Production

    92,455 MWh/year

  • CO2 saved

    16,641 Tonnes/year

Ardrossan Wind Farm is an impressive sight, sitting high above the town of Ardrossan on the Ayrshire coast. The site is noted for its very favourable wind resources and has historically produced a capacity of around 36%.Applications to extend the operational life of Ardrossan Wind Farm. Ardrossan Wind Farm comprises 15 wind turbines each rated at 2 MW with an overall site capacity of 30 MW. Twelve wind turbines began commercial operations in August 2004 and the wind farm was extended with the addition of three further wind turbines in 2009.

North Ayrshire council have approved two planning applications to extend the two planning consents for Ardrossan Wind Farm by an additional 10-years.

Hennøy

  • Norway
  • Wind
  • Operational
  • Capacity

    50 MW

  • Production

    158,932 MWh/year

  • CO2 saved

    117 Tonnes/year

This farm consists of 12 wind turbines. The project also included a 3-mile access road, 4.8 miles of internal roads, a new ro-ro jetty on the shore, a substation with a control room and electricity infrastructure such as cables, switchgears and a transformer (55 MVA).The grid company, Sogn og Fjordane Energi Nett, built a new overhead power line to connect the site to the regional grid. It is estimated that the plant will generate up to 174 GWh of electricity per year, enough clean energy to supply between 8,700 and 10,900 households.
